Scanning-Probe-Induced Local Decomposition of Solid Germanium Monoxide Films: The Nano-Pattering of Germanium

The possibility of forming the Ge-based wires with the nanoscale's lateral resolution using the local modification of GeO((sol)) films by a scanning probe microscope was demonstrated for the first time. The property of the solid germanium monoxide films, namely, their metastability, was used to decompose the GeO film on Ge and GeO(2) by running the high-density electric current under the probe of the atomic force microscope.
